Blessed Sacrament Parish has Bills fever and hopes it spreads. The Buffalo parish will host a Mass, family picnic, and Bills tailgate party on Sunday, Oct. 6. Bishop Michael W. Fisher has made the following appointments. Father Patryk G. Sobczyk has been appointed full-time chaplain at Mercy Hospital of Buffalo, effective Oct. 1. Catholic Charities of Buffalo celebrated the opening of a new location for its Lovejoy Food Pantry. Catholic agencies in western North Carolina are mobilizing to help with relief efforts amid devastating flooding caused by the remnants of Hurricane Helene, which dumped torrential rain on mountain communities there leaving serious damage and dozens dead. Canisius University announced the appointment of Lawrence T. Potter Jr., Ph.D., as its new vice president for Academic Affairs, effective Nov. 11.
